    No doubt, Chambers definitely won... and it's a very good win for his career. However he had a completely flat footed opponent, out of gas, standing in front of him with his guard down, and completely unable to avoid punches. It wasn't as if Peter is tricky as hell and was setting traps. He really had nothing for Chambers tonight. If Peter was in great shape, and was playing defense, setting traps for Chambers and looking to catch him with something nasty as Chambers overextended himself, that would be one thing. The point is that Eddie couldn't miss Sam's head or body, and completely outclassed him when he would open up. Sam was just sucking air, pushing arm punches, and eating shots all night long. Sam was also bringing the fight to Eddie, which makes it even easier for Chambers to light him up.
